Chavanwadi
Chavanwadi is a village located in Patan tehsil of Satara district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 35km away from sub-district headquarter Patan (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Satara. As per 2009 stats, Chavanwadi Nanegaon is the gram panchayat of Chavanwadi village.

About Chavanwadi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chavanwadi is 564281. The village spans a total geographical area of 314 hectares. Karad is nearest town to Chavanwadi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 41km away.
When it comes to local governance, Chavanwadi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Patan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Satara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Chavanwadi
Below is a concise population overview of Chavanwadi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 687 | 355 | 332 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 98 | 57 | 41 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 3 | 1 | 2 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 471 | 270 | 201 |
Illiterate Population | 216 | 85 | 131 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Chavanwadi village:
- The total population of Chavanwadi village is around 687, including approximately 355 males and 332 females, with a sex ratio of 935 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 98 children aged 0–6 years in Chavanwadi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Chavanwadi village has 3 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Chavanwadi village is about 68.56%, with male literacy at 76.06% and female literacy at 60.54%.
- There are around 138 households in Chavanwadi village.
Connectivity of Chavanwadi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chavanwadi. As per the 2011 stats, Chavanwadi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
